“My wife and I had an amazing date night at St Tropez Bistro. As we are not from Saskatoon we were intrigued that the place had been open for 46 years and figured they had to be doing something right. The dimly lit dining room featuring early 20th century jazz sounds transported us down South to a familiar world of fine dining. The mushroom tartines were our favorite bite but the pickerel was close behind. The gnocchi was our favorite taste of the night. The blue curaçao whiskey drink was an interesting take on a whiskey sour and my wife loved her aura borealis mocktail. Service was great and so was dessert.“
